annuity |
a regular yearly income paid at fixed intervals and produced by money invested or by an insurance contract. |
articulate |
able to speak or express oneself in a clear way. |
bonanza |
anything that brings great wealth and prosperity. |
compulsive |
driven by an obsession or compulsion. |
constrain |
to keep within tight restrictions; confine. |
disavow |
to deny having (knowledge, intention, or the like). |
inconsistency |
an instance of contradiction or illogic. |
kindred |
a group of related people, such as a tribe or clan. |
noteworthy |
deserving attention; remarkable. |
pertinacious |
tenacious in purpose, opinion, or the like; persevering. |
possessive |
having a strong desire to own and keep things. |
posterity |
all generations to come. |
pursuant |
following on or proceeding from (usually followed by "to"). |
rebate |
a part of a payment that is returned. |
timorous |
showing or marked by fear; fearful; timid. |
